How much does it cost to rent a home in NOMA?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
NOMA 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,881 | $3,595 | $9,500 |
NOMA 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,974 | $3,400 | $10,000+ |
NOMA 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,263 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about NOMA
What type of rentals are currently available in NOMA?
There are currently 3237 Apartments for Rent in NOMA, CA with pricing that ranges from $875 to $19,500. There are also 84 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in NOMA ranging from $1,300 to $19,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in NOMA?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in NOMA ranges from $1,300 to $19,500 with an average monthly rent of $5,558.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in NOMA?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in NOMA range from $1,550 to $10,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$3,400 to $19,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,800 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$4,950.
